Hi, just finished assembling a Ceasar chorus today. Everything works as it should except the rate knob. The led indicator for the rate is flashing very fast, and when playing you can tell the rate is very high. Turning the rate pot in either direction has no effect on it. I have a B100K installed per the build documentation/parts list. I figured initially it was a bad pot, so I swapped it out still having the same issue. I tried a B250K to see if it'd behave any differently still the same issue. I've attached photos of my board before the pots, jacks, etc... where installed and have no idea where to begin trouble shooting.

Seems to be a grounding issue. If I ground off the right lug of the rate pot to the back of the pot or the enclosure it starts working, but only has about 3/4 of the sweep of the pot. Now to figure out how to track that down.

It's likely it's a 12k considering reading it backwards would yield a 21k resistor which are not common at all, and it looks the same as the other 12k resistors you have installed. 22K would be Red/Red/Black/Red/Brown, and R12 is in the LFO section where you are having troubles.
